The book provides an essential perspective on the creation of Ozzy Osbourne’s first two solo albums, Blizzard of Ozz (1980) and Diary of a Madman (1981). Daisley details the incredible creative chemistry between himself, guitarist Randy Rhoads, and drummer Lee Kerslake. Conversely, he also exposes the severe legal and financial battles with Sharon and Ozzy Osbourne regarding songwriting credits and royalties—infamously resulting in his and Kerslake's performance tracks being re-recorded by other musicians for the 2002 reissues. 3.
